Speaker placement
Front speakers : Place to the front left and right of the listening
position. Front speakers are required for all surround modes.
Center speaker: Place front and center. This speaker stabilizes the
sound image and helps recreate sound motion. Be sure to connect
a center speaker when using the Dolby 3 Stereo mode.
Surround speakers : Place to the direct left and right, or slightly
behind, the listening position at even heights, approximately 1 meter
above the ears of the listeners. These speakers recreate sound
motion and atmosphere. Required for surround playback.
Subwoofer: Reproduces powerful deep bass sounds.
• Although the ideal surround system consists of all the speakers
listed above, if you don't have a center speaker or a subwoofer, you
can divide those signals between the available speakers in the
speaker settings steps to obtain the best possible surround repro¬
duction from the speakers you have available.

Channel space switching
(Except for the USA, Canada, UK, Europe and Auxtratia)
The space between radio channels has been set to the one that
prevails in the area to which the system is shipped. However, if the
current channel space setting does not match the setting in the area
where the system is to be used, for instance when you move from area
1 or area 2 shown in the following table or vice versa, proper reception
of AM/FM broadcasts cannot be expected. In this case, change the
channel space setting in accordance with your area by referring to
the following table.

Loading the batteries
O
Remove the cover.
0 Insert the batteries.
0 Close the cover.
*
Insert four AAA-size (LR03) batteries as indicated by the polarity
markings.
Operation
When the STANDBY indicator is lit. the power turns ON when you press
the POWER key on the remote control. When the power comes ON,
press the key you want to operate.

1. The supplied batteries may have shorter lives than ordinary batteries
due to use during operation checks.
2. Replace all four batteries with new ones when you notice a shortening
of the distance from which the remote control will operate or if the
remote control blinks 5 times when you press a key. The remote control
is designed to retain set up codes in memory while you change
batteries.
3. Placing the remote sensor in direct sunlight, or in direct light from a
high frequency fluorescent lamp may cause a malfunction.
In such a case, change the location of the system installation to
prevent malfunction.
